Hi all,
I have a list of files that I'd like to mark the duplicates. I can't use just the file name because some files have the same name but aren't the same file. As I understand it COUNTIF can't be used with multiple comparisons. I've tried CONCATENATE several of the columns and then using COUNTIF but it doesn't seem to work. Example of what I'm looking for.... File A, 400k, 9/23/09, Duplicate File A, 450k, 9/23/09 File A, 400k, 9/23/09, Duplicate Thanks in advance Toney |
